- Erreur
-
- Erreur lors du chargement des données de flux.
Tutoriaux
JQuery tente de s'imposer dans le monde du web2.0 et à entièrement réussi son paris. Son code est très simple, intuitif et vraiment efficace. Le principe de jQuery est d'écrire le moins de code possible afin d'en réaliser le plus possible.
jQuery propose 5 facons d'utiliser l'Ajax :
* load : Utilisé pour charger simplement le contenu d'une page PHP ou HTML.
* get : Utilisé pour charger le contenu d'une page PHP avec la méthode GET.
* getJSON : Utilisé pour charger le contenu d'une page PHP avec la méthode GET et récupéré le json de retour.
* post : Utilisé pour charger le contenu d'une page PHP avec la méthode POST.
* getScript : Utilisé pour charger un fichier javascript en local.
De plus, JQuery propose 6 événements récupérable durant l'éxécution d'une requête AJAX :
* complete : Exécute une fonction quand la requête AJAX est terminée.
* error : Exécute une fonction quand la requête AJAX contient une erreur.
* send : Exécute une fonction quand la requête AJAX va commencer.
* start : Exécute une fonction quand la requête AJAX commence.
* stop : Exécute une fonction quand la requête AJAX s'arrête.
* success : Exécute une fonction quand la requête AJAX est terminé avec succès.
Exemple d'utilisation :
GET
// Page test.php
echo $_GET['nom'] .' '.$_GET['email'];
// Fichier test.js
$(document).ready(function () { // On verifie que la page est chargée
$.get("test.php",{nom: "Dave", email: "
Cette adresse email est protégée contre les robots des spammeurs, vous devez activer Javascript pour la voir.
"},
function success(data){ // Au succès on renvoie le résultat de la requête
alert(data); // Affichage
});
});
POST
// Page test.php
echo $_POST['nom'] .' '. $_POST['email'];
// Fichier test.js
$(document).ready(function () {
$.post("test.php", { nom: "Dave", email: "
Cette adresse email est protégée contre les robots des spammeurs, vous devez activer Javascript pour la voir.
" },
function success(data){
alert(data);
});
});
POST JSON
// Page test.php
echo json_encode($_POST);
// Fichier test.js
$(document).ready(function () {
$.post("test.php", { nom: "Dave", email: "
Cette adresse email est protégée contre les robots des spammeurs, vous devez activer Javascript pour la voir.
" },
function success(data){
alert(data.nom +' '+data.email);
},"json"); // On passe en paramètre optionnel le type de retour ici JSON
});

Par joe , juillet 13, 2009
Par kamal , août 10, 2009
j'ai copie coller votre script et il m'affiche :
alert ===>
normalement il faut afficher ===> Dave \n Cette adresse email est protégée contre les robots des spammeurs, vous devez activer Javascript pour la voir. '> Cette adresse email est protégée contre les robots des spammeurs, vous devez activer Javascript pour la voir.
!!!!!!!!!!!
Par youyou , octobre 04, 2009
je veus savoir comment afficher un message d'attente, ou un gif pendant l'exécution de la requete ajax avec jquery??
merci d'avance
Par Ed Hardy , mai 13, 2010
Par fiwedding , juin 12, 2010
















Voici mon problème, je n'arrive pas a récupérer (dans le cadre d'un login) les variables nom et mot de passe lors d'un fetch_row donc l'utilisation de ajax me parais bien compliquer car ça ne passe pas...
Pourrais tu m'éxpliquer comment utiliser le résultat de variables php via ajax avec jQuery s'il te plait?
Merci d'avance